Runbook fragment — GreenLoft Controller, account recovery. When humidity sensors on the Verdana greenhouse units drift beyond 4% over baseline, the controller locks its admin console to prevent bad calibration writes. Recovery requires re-seating the sensor bus, confirming drift has settled below threshold for ten minutes, then re-authenticating on the local panel. The panel rejects cached credentials after a drift lockout, so the operator must use the offline recovery path. Enter the following passphrase when the panel prompts for it.

vault phrase of tajef-tafog = istox-sorax-zorox-casok-holox-kelix-weneth-drueth-casion

Following the mid-year review, the Aldermere Group proposes holding branch training spend flat overall, with a reallocation toward the Fenwick certification programme and away from general workshops. Branch managers should note that the Dunmore and Carroway sites will pilot the new Lanternly learning platform in Q1, funded centrally. Travel allowances for training remain capped at last year's levels pending the autumn forecast. Allocations per branch will be confirmed once the plan referenced below has been approved.

board note of kagep-yahig: Only 9 of the 120 pilot accounts renewed Quenix, so a churn review is set for April 1.

Handover Note — Master Keys

Marta,

The full set of master keys for the Aldercroft building is in the small steel case on my desk, tagged and counted: eleven keys, per the log sheet inside. Two are newly cut for the annex doors. A courier from Keystone Secure collects the case Wednesday for recutting. Log the collection time in the register. The confidential hand-over instruction is as follows:

courier memo of bagap-bagef: the juleth queniel courier leaves the weniel praeth belath ledger at gate 2533 under passcode 428024

## Sweepline Environments

Sweepline is the data-retention sweeper for the Corvetta platform. It runs nightly in staging and hourly in production, purging records past their retention window. Release managers should confirm sweep cadence before any schema cutover, since in-flight purges can block migrations. The production environment uses the configuration values listed below.

service settings:
PRAIX_LOG_LEVEL=error
PRAIX_METRICS_HOST=metrics.praix.qorvelcorp.corp
PRAIX_POOL_SIZE=16